发布网友 发布时间:2022-04-21 20:11
共4个回答
热心网友 时间:2023-11-04 10:00
对于这个问题,你可以有一下解决办法:
①利用单元格range的属性entireColumn
如:更改sheet2上A列单元格的列宽为50
Sheet2.Range("a1").EntireColumn.ColumnWidth = 50→ →上面这句话也可以用下面这句话代替
Sheet2.Range("A1").ColumnWidth = 50→ →当然也可以用下面这句话代替
sheet2.Columns("A:A").ColumnWidth =50②可以更改工作表中所有单元格的列宽,利用cells的属性cloumnWidth
Sheet2.Cells.ColumnWidth = 50
注:用以上方式也可以设置行高,rowHeight属性,方法相同;
希望能帮到你,谢谢!
热心网友 时间:2023-11-04 10:00
Columns("A:A").ColumnWidth = 18.88热心网友 时间:2023-11-04 10:01
With ActiveCell热心网友 时间:2023-11-04 10:01
录制个宏,再修改数值最简单。